Registering your trip with the Yemen embassy is crucial for ensuring safety, effective communication, and access to support during emergencies. In case of natural disasters such as earthquakes or floods, having your travel information on file enables the embassy to provide timely updates and assistance. Additionally, during political unrest, registered individuals can be prioritized for evacuation and advice on safe areas to avoid. Medical emergencies can also benefit significantly from registration; the embassy can coordinate with local healthcare services and facilitate medical evacuations if necessary. Can the Yemen embassy assist in legal issues abroad?
Yes, the Yemen embassy can provide guidance and support in legal matters, helping you understand local laws and connecting you to legal representation if necessary.
What should I do if I lose my Yemen passport in Panama?
If you lose your passport, report the loss to local authorities and contact the Yemen embassy immediately for assistance in obtaining a replacement.
Can the Yemen embassy help me find medical services if I fall ill in Panama?
Yes, the embassy can assist in locating medical facilities and provide information about local healthcare services during your stay.
What steps should I take if I am detained in Panama?
Immediately inform the Yemen embassy about your detention. They can help ensure your rights are upheld and connect you with legal assistance.
